Leiden

We cycled through to Leiden, with great ease from the house boat we were staying in.  We have never cycled in Holland before and we were so impressed by the ease of getting around. 
 We parked up in the main town square and had a fabulous day. The weather was still very good.
We took the Rembrandt walking tour which took us through the oldest streets and squares in Leiden.  Apparently if Rembrandt were around today he would be able to find his way around, as this part of the city is so unchanged even 400 years later.
The photo shows a small garden close to Rembrandts birthplace.  We very much enjoyed the University Botanic Gardens, which are the oldest in Holland.
We felt that Leiden was like a much smaller and quieter Amsterdam.
